The backstory to BMO Field is long and complicated. But bottom line, the Toronto lakefront venue is the little stadium that grew. How it began is a tangled web, with the stadium tied to Canada hosting the 2007 FIFA U-20 World Cup and Toronto getting an expansion Major League Soccer franchise.
